Milano/ Malpensa vs Tindouf Climate & Distance Between

Algeria flag
  • The distance between Milano/ Malpensa, Italy and Tindouf, Algeria is approximately 2,489 km or 1,547 mi.
  • To reach Milano/ Malpensa in this distance one would set out from Tindouf bearing 32.2°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Milano/ Malpensa bearing 42.4° or NE .
  • Milano/ Malpensa has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Tindouf has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Milano/ Malpensa is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ome whereas Tindouf is in or near the subtropical desert bi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 11.8 °C (21.3°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.6 °C (1.1°F) more in Milano/ Malpensa.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1022.7 mm (40.3 in) more which is equivalent to 1022.7 l/m² (25.1 US gal/ft²) or 10,227,000 l/ha (1,093,334 US gal/ac) more. About 18 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 17.9° lower in Milano/ Malpensa than in Tindouf.
  • Relative humidity levels are 46.3%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 4.1°C (7.3°F) higher.
